WebOct 26, 2024 · GIT is only source version control system and it does not provide build automation and other release management feature but TFS do. TFS (centralized version source control) : TFS is a centralized version source control system. No concept of local check-in in TFS and local work-space always connect to central repository. WebSep 5, 2024 · In the Git world, you merge the pull request, while in the world of TFVC, you merge the shelveset. Although both processes seem very similar, there is a crucial difference: In TFVC, the reviewer marks the review request with “Looks good” to approve the changes. But that’s all they can do. WebJun 8, 2024 · Git pros and cons Git's other major draw among version control systems is that it is truly distributed, said Jeff Druin, DevOps manager at a healthcare provider. Other tools, such as Subversion, are centralized. Centralized version control means that one main copy of a project exists in one place.
